diff TaskManager/kernel/ppe/TaskManagerImpl.h @ 475:e083c4ff91c1

BufferManager removed.
author Shinji KONO <kono@ie.u-ryukyu.ac.jp>
date Sun, 04 Oct 2009 11:29:50 +0900 (2009-10-04)
parents eab18aa0c7f6
children 5bda98b0b56d
line wrap: on
line diff
--- a/TaskManager/kernel/ppe/TaskManagerImpl.h	Sat Oct 03 10:50:16 2009 +0900
+++ b/TaskManager/kernel/ppe/TaskManagerImpl.h	Sun Oct 04 11:29:50 2009 +0900
@@ -2,9 +2,12 @@
 #define INCLUDED_TASK_MANAGER_IMPL
 
 #include "MailManager.h"
-#include "BufferManager.h"
 #include "ListData.h"
 #include "Scheduler.h"
+#include "TaskListInfo.h"
+#include "TaskQueueInfo.h"
+#include "HTaskInfo.h"
+
 
 class TaskManagerImpl {
 public:
@@ -16,7 +19,11 @@
     int machineNum;
     TaskQueuePtr activeTaskQueue;
     TaskQueuePtr waitTaskQueue;
-    BufferManager *bufferManager;
+
+    /* variables */
+    TaskListInfo *taskListImpl;
+    TaskQueueInfo *taskQueueImpl;
+    HTaskInfo *htaskImpl;
 
     /* functions */
     // system